Spam-n-Eggs & Taters (Ham Bonus)



Seems I’m due to post a Breakfast, so I picked one of my Favorites.
I usually just have 2 or 3 Eggs every morning, with only 2 little Sausages, or a couple slices of Bacon.
But since I decided to post this one, I made it more worth posting:

So I started with a Leftover Baked Tater, and sliced it up as thin as I could without making them fall apart.
Then I opened a can of "Bacon" Spam. That’s the Spam that has the lowest amount of Sodium.
So I fried the Spam & Taters up just right, and finally made a couple of “Over-Medium” Eggs to fill the plate.
